About the Role

Join NFU Mutual as we continue to build our Quality Engineering Centre of Excellence. This is an exciting opportunity to help transform how quality is embedded throughout the product lifecycle, enabling delivery teams to improve speed, confidence and customer outcomes.

We're looking for a Quality Engineering Architect to provide technical leadership across assigned domains and products. Working closely with Engineers, Product Teams, Architects and Quality Engineers, you'll help design and implement modern quality engineering approaches, and automation strategies that support scalable, secure and reliable delivery.

You will play a key role in evolving and embedding the Quality Engineering Framework, creating patterns, standards, guardrails and reusable assets that enable teams to integrate quality into every stage of change lifecycle. You'll support the adoption of automation-first approaches, contribute to the evaluation of emerging technologies including AI and GenAI, and help shape the future direction of quality engineering across NFU Mutual.

Working across multiple teams, you'll provide expert guidance on quality engineering architecture, automation frameworks, tooling and technical approaches. You'll partner with Senior Quality Engineers and delivery teams to address complex quality challenges, manage technical dependencies and improve engineering effectiveness through coaching, mentoring and technical leadership.

A key aspect of the role is using data-driven insights to identify trends, risks and opportunities for improvement. You'll help delivery teams measure quality outcomes, improve automation effectiveness and support compliance, governance and regulatory requirements through clear, evidence-based recommendations.

About You

You're an experienced Quality Engineering professional with a strong background in test architecture, automation and modern software engineering practices. You are a passionate technical leader, improving quality outcomes through technical innovation, coaching and collaboration.

You bring excellent communication and stakeholder management skills, building trusted relationships across delivery, engineering and architecture communities. You are comfortable influencing without direct authority, balancing strategic thinking with pragmatic delivery and driving adoption of best practice across complex environments.

You'll also bring (essential)

  • Proven experience designing and implementing quality engineering frameworks, automation strategies and test architecture approaches.
  • Strong understanding of modern engineering practices including CI/CD, test automation and DevOps.
  • Experience with automation frameworks and tools such as Playwright, Selenium, Rest Assured or equivalent.
  • Strong knowledge of software development lifecycles, systems integration and quality engineering practices.
  • Experience providing technical coaching, mentoring and guidance to engineers and quality professionals.
  • Ability to analyse quality metrics, identify trends and use data to influence decision making.

Benefits and Rewards

  • Salary - Circa £65,000
  • Annual bonus (up to 17.5% of salary)
  • Contributory pension scheme, up to 20%, including your 8% contribution
  • 25 days annual leave + bank holidays + buy/sell/save holiday trading scheme
  • A Family Friendly policy that helps you balance your work and family responsibilities
  • Access to savings at High Street brands, travel and supermarkets
  • £20 contribution to a monthly gym membership – subject to T&Cs
  • Health and wellbeing plan - cashback for dentist, opticians, physio and more
  • Access to voluntary benefits, including health assessments, private medical insurance and dental insurance
  • Employee Volunteering - volunteer in the community for one day each year
  • Unlimited access to Refer a Friend £500 bonus scheme
  • Life Assurance cover of 4 x salary
  • Employee discounts of 15% on a range of NFU Mutual insurance policies.
  • Salary sacrifice employee car scheme - subject to eligibility
